Latest revision as of 02:21, 22 September 2007

P=Fss(u) (1+u/m)+ fssD((2u/m)+(D/m)+1)

u=growth rate m=maturation constant for oxygen-dependent fluorophore activation of GFP
D=first-order rate constant for protease-mediated degredation
fss=exponential-phase steady state concentration of GFP
P=rate of promoter driven production of GFP

Main Idea:

Flouresence/absorbance per hour is measured by the rate of production, the amount of GFP in the cell, and the time GFP stays in the cell. The equation is one of the measures used to characterize the mutant promoters' strength.
